Awen Delaval
Siem Reap - Cambodia
I created a fabric from the lotus flower
0 Like
Partager
It was by chance that this Frenchman discovered the fibres in the lotus stem resembled silk threads. That was all the impetus he needed to pursue the production of a vegetable silk fabric. It was a diamond in the rough.
